Unified Appointment Registration Rules

08.07.2024

We are pleased to inform you that starting from July 8, 2024, we are standardizing the procedures for booking and handling appointments for the following services:

  • Personal appearance
  • Fingerprints
  • Travel/identity document

For all cases handled at the Department*:

Appointments to address the aforementioned requirements must be registered through the case status tracking page. Visits will be managed using a ticket machine system, eliminating the need for personal calls to clients.

Change in the Rules for Handling Fingerprint Completion Visits

14.06.2024

We would like to inform you that, starting from 17/06/2024, we are changing the process for handling visits registered for personal appearance/fingerprint completion. Ultimately, these visits will be managed using a ticket machine without the need to call the customer, similar to other online bookings.

25th anniversary in the Provincial Police Headquarters in Poznań

28.05.2024

On May 24, 2024, the Provincial Police Headquarters in Poznań celebrated the 25th anniversary of the Administrative Proceedings Department. The employees of this department perform a range of tasks daily to improve the safety of the residents of Wielkopolska Province. Their duties include, among others, providing opinions on residence applications of foreigners, for which they constantly cooperate with our Department for Foreigners. 

ATTENTION – STAY ALERT!

15.05.2024

We want to alert you that recently, we have identified cases of impersonation of employees from the Department for Foreigners, The Office of Wielkopolska Province in Poznan. These individuals may attemt to contact you by phone, pretending to be officials, with the intent to extort personal information, financial data, or money.

Additional submission point at the Department for Foreigners in Poznań - UPDATE

30.04.2024

We kindly inform you that starting from 6th May 2024, the opening hours of submission points located at Plac Wolności 17 will change. 

Here are the opening hours for the Submission Point at Service Room A:

Monday to Friday: 8:15 am to 3:15 pm

Here are the opening hours for the Submission Point at Service Room B:

Monday to Friday: 11:45 am to 3:15 pm

The above-described organization of the submission points in Poznań will be in force until further notice.
